Devfest Lille 2024 : vers un numérique responsable et performant

14.11.2024
3 minutes

Le Devfest Lille 2024 a été une véritable mine d'or d'informations sur divers aspects du développement technologique et du numérique responsable. Cet événement a rassemblé des experts pour discuter des tendances actuelles, des défis et des solutions dans le domaine du numérique.

 

Présents à cet évènement, nous explorerons, dans cet article, les thèmes principaux abordés lors de cette conférence, notamment le numérique responsable, la loi de Moore, la loi de Wirth, et les obésiciels. Nous verrons également comment ces concepts peuvent être appliqués de manière opérationnelle pour améliorer l'efficacité et la durabilité de nos technologies.

 

Le numérique responsable

Le numérique responsable est une démarche d'amélioration continue visant à réduire l'empreinte écologique et sociale des technologies numériques. Cette approche englobe plusieurs aspects cruciaux :

 

1.     Réduction de l'impact environnemental

En France, la fabrication des équipements numériques représente 41 % de la consommation énergétique et 83 % des émissions de gaz à effet de serre (GES). Des initiatives comme celles promues par GreenIT visent à réduire ces impacts par des stratégies d'éco-conception et de gestion durable des ressources.

 

2.     Amélioration de l'impact social

L'extraction des minerais nécessaires à la fabrication des équipements, souvent réalisée dans des conditions de travail déplorables et l'inclusivité des services numériques sont des préoccupations majeures. Par exemple, en République Démocratique du Congo, plus de 40 000 enfants travaillent dans les mines de cobalt, selon Amnesty International. L'inclusivité des services numériques est également un point clé.

 

3.     Loi de Moore

La loi de Moore, énoncée par Gordon Moore, prédit que le nombre de transistors dans un microprocesseur double tous les deux ans, entraînant une augmentation exponentielle de la puissance des microprocesseurs. Cette loi, vérifiée depuis les années 1970, a contribué à l'essor rapide des technologies numériques.

 

4.     Loi de Wirth

En contrepoint, la loi de Wirth, formulée par Niklaus Wirth, stipule que les logiciels ralentissent à mesure que le matériel devient plus puissant. Cela s'exprime fréquemment par l'aphorisme : « Ce qu’Intel vous donne, Microsoft vous le retire ». Cette loi souligne le besoin d'optimiser les logiciels pour éviter une consommation excessive de ressources matérielles.

 

5.     Les obésiciels

Les obésiciels sont des logiciels qui, au fil des mises à jour, deviennent de plus en plus gourmands en ressources. Cela conduit à une dégradation de la performance perçue des appareils, même si leur puissance matérielle n'a pas diminué. Une solution pour contrer ce phénomène est l'éco-conception de logiciels, qui vise à maintenir l'efficacité tout en minimisant la consommation de ressources.

6.     Éco-conception et outils

L'éco-conception de services numériques implique l'utilisation d'outils automatisés pour mesurer et optimiser l'impact environnemental des logiciels. Des conférences comme celles de Devfest Lille 2024 proposent des méthodes et des outils pour intégrer cette approche dans le développement quotidien des logiciels (6 † source). Par exemple, l'utilisation de l'API Popover permet d'afficher des contenus de manière plus efficace et cohérente, réduisant ainsi les besoins en ressources.

7.     Lisibilité vs Performance

Un autre thème clé abordé lors de la conférence est le dilemme entre lisibilité et performance du code. Un code lisible est plus facile à maintenir et à comprendre pour les développeurs, ce qui est crucial pour les projets à long terme. Cependant, il est parfois nécessaire de sacrifier un peu de lisibilité pour optimiser la performance, surtout lorsque le code doit traiter de grandes quantités de données rapidement.

Le Devfest Lille 2024 a mis en lumière l'importance de concilier performance technologique et responsabilité numérique. En adoptant des pratiques d'éco-conception et en optimisant à la fois le matériel et les logiciels, nous pouvons développer des technologies plus durables et efficaces. Pour en savoir plus sur l'impact environnemental du numérique en France, vous pouvez consulter les ressources de GreenIT.

 

Sources et références :

- GreenIT: [Impacts Environnementaux du Numérique en France]
- Amnesty International: [Enfants dans les mines de cobalt]
- Devfest Lille 2024: [Automatisation des outils d'éco-conception]